Product Introduction

Overview

The Texas Instruments SN74LVC2G74DCTR is a single positive-edge-triggered D-type flip-flop integrated circuit. It is part of the 74LVC family, known for its low-voltage CMOS logic. This device operates over a wide voltage range from 1.65 V to 5.5 V, making it versatile for various applications. The flip-flop features clear and preset inputs, allowing for precise control over the output states. It is packaged in an 8-pin SSOP (Shrink Small Outline Package) and is RoHS compliant, ensuring environmental sustainability.

Key Features

  • Operates over a wide voltage range from 1.65 V to 5.5 V, supporting 5 V VCC operation.
  • Positive edge-triggered D-type flip-flop with clear and preset inputs.
  • Low power consumption with a maximum quiescent current of 10 µA.
  • High output drive capability of ±24 mA at 3.3 V.
  • ESD protection exceeds JESD 22 standards (2000 V human-body model, 200 V machine model, 1000 V charged-device model).
  • Supports live insertion, partial-power-down mode, and back-drive protection through Ioff circuitry.
  • NanoFree™ package technology for reduced size and improved performance.
